Business Development Associate identifies and nurtures strategic relationships with partners or potential customers. Assists in the development of a strong pipeline of new business opportunities through direct or indirect customer contact and prospecting. Being a Business Development Associate works with marketing, sales, and product development teams to implement business development initiatives. Requires a bachelor's degree in business, finance or marketing. Additionally, Business Development Associate typically reports to a supervisor or manager. The Business Development Associate occasionally directed in several aspects of the work. Gaining exposure to some of the complex tasks within the job function. To be a Business Development Associate typically requires 2-4 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

    Headquartered in Stamford with regional offices in New Haven and New London, the Women’s
    Business Development Council (WBDC) is the statewide leader of entrepreneurial education
    for women. WBDC’s mission is to support economic prosperity for women and strengthen
    communities through entrepreneurial and financial education services that create and grow
    sustainable jobs and businesses across Connecticut. WBDC educates, motivates and
    empowers women to achieve economic independence and self-sufficiency. Since 1997, WBDC
    has educated and trained more than 16,670 clients in all of Connecticut’s 169 towns—helping
    women to launch, sustain and scale over 12,500 businesses, create and maintain over 25,880
    jobs in Connecticut, and access more than $28.7 million in capital. Visit ctwbdc.org for more
    information.

Stamford (/ˈstæmfərd/) is a city in Fairfield County, Connecticut, United States. According to the 2010 census, the population of the city is 122,643. As of 2017, according to the Census Bureau, the population of Stamford had risen to 131,000, making it the third-largest city in the state (behind Bridgeport and New Haven) and the seventh-largest city in New England. Approximately 30 miles (50 kilometers) from Manhattan, Stamford is in the Bridgeport-Stamford-Norwalk Metro area which is a part of the Greater New York metropolitan area.
